Become a channel sponsor and you will get access to exclusive bonuses. More: Strong typhoon Khanun has hit Okinawa Prefecture in southern Japan. According to Okinawa Electric Power, 164,000 homes remain without power. In addition, transport links were disrupted in the prefecture, more than 300 flights were canceled, and ferries were suspended. Forecasters warn that up to 500 mm (20 inches) of rain could fall in southern regions of Japan before the end of the week. Now the typhoon is raging near the island of Okinawa and is heading towards the East China Sea. The wind speed in its central part is about 160 km/h (99 mph) with gusts up to 210 km/h (130 mph).
